    I’m a sole trader, not VAT registered, most invoices are simply hand written receipts, and I wonder if anyone knows of any really simple bookeeping software that does nothing more than keep a tally of income and the various categories of expenses. Most packages seem vastly over the top for what I need.

    I use Do$h Cashbook by Mamut Software. This is the programme my accountants told me to use some 10 or so years ago. Simple to use and quite cheap in comparison to some out there. I simply send a cd backup of my accounts at year end and they work out all the rest. I’m pretty sure they do a trial version that you can have a play with.

    Many thanks for all your replies; I’ve ended up with ‘Home Bookeeping lite’ by Keepsoft which is (a)free and (b) does everything I need for now. If ever I need to print everything out I will have to update to the full version for a small fee. But this package (which I think is designed more for keeping track of personal finances) was quickly adapted to do everything I need and nothing I don’t need!

    All this came about because Microsoft Money (which I’ve used for years) is way out of date and seems to have no way to tot up and categorise income at the end of the year. Expenses yes, but as far as income’s concerned it assumes you’re an American on a fixed salary.
